Problems solved by technology

At present, the main models of potato harvesters sold on the market are potato harvesters with excavation and strip collection operations. This type of machinery will inevitably require a lot of manpower to grade, pick and bag potatoes. This operation mode is not only efficient Low and invisibly increases the cost of potatoes. When encountering concentrated harvesting time, once encountering extreme weather, a large number of potatoes cannot be picked by grading, and growers will face huge losses; some large-scale potatoes Growers have begun to adopt the "2+2" harvesting mode, which mainly includes potato harvesters with lateral conveying devices and large potato combine harvesters. Farmers first dig two rows through potato harvesters with lateral conveying devices. Potatoes, and the potatoes are transported to the adjacent unharvested two-row potato furrow on the side, and then four rows of potatoes are harvested at a time by a large-scale combined potato harvester, and the lifting and loading operations are completed at the same time, and the harvested potatoes are transported back to the Warehouse screening and grading storage processing
At present, under this mode, the potato harvester with side conveying matched with the large-scale combined potato harvester is still immature, and some of them are only simple equipment modified by the user, with low work efficiency and high potato damage rate. Very inconvenient

Abstract

The invention relates to a potato harvester capable of achieving lateral conveying. The potato harvester comprises pressing ridge cutting devices, digging shovels, a main frame assembly, a lateral conveying device, a traveling rack assembly, a front conveying chain and a rear conveying chain. The pressing ridge cutting devices and the digging shovels are connected to the front end of the main frame assembly. The lateral conveying device and the traveling rack assembly are connected to the rear end of a main frame. The harvester can finish digging, conveying, separating and laterally conveying the potatoes at a time, and is completely suitable for a 2+2 harvesting mode for harvesting four lines of the potatoes at a time, in the operating process, the harvester is used for digging the two lines of the potatoes, and conveying the potatoes into furrows of the adjacent two lines of the potatoes which are not harvested at the side face, and a large union potato harvester is used for harvesting the four lines of the potatoes at a time.

Description

Technical field [0001] The invention relates to a potato harvesting equipment, in particular to a potato harvester capable of realizing lateral transportation. Background technique [0002] Potato is the fourth largest food crop in my country. It has a large planting area, and the output of fresh potatoes ranks first in the world. Potatoes occupies an important position in the agricultural economy. The realization of potato harvesting mechanization will no doubt promote the development of the potato industry. [0003] With the implementation of the nationwide land transfer policy, the degree of production concentration has further increased. In the future, agricultural production will inevitably gradually develop on a large scale. Only a small number of people remain behind in the rural areas, and they are also concentrated in the scope of the elderly, women and children.
